An incident at the San Bernardino County jail has shocked authorities and residents alike, as an inmate attempted to stab another inmate and a sheriff’s deputy with a makeshift knife. The inmate, identified as Christopher Lommie Jackson, allegedly crafted the weapon while incarcerated at the West Valley Detention Center in Rancho Cucamonga.

The altercation took place on Tuesday afternoon, with Jackson targeting a 28-year-old inmate with the jail-made metal knife. When deputies intervened, Jackson then turned his focus on a 45-year-old deputy, knocking him to the ground in a violent attack. Fortunately, other deputies were able to intervene and prevent further harm.

Video footage captured by the Sheriff’s Department shows the harrowing moment when Jackson lunged towards the deputy with the knife in hand, resulting in a struggle that ended with the deputy sustaining moderate injuries to his face. The deputy was later hospitalized and subsequently released, while the condition of the other inmate involved in the incident remains unknown.

Legal Ramifications

Christopher Lommie Jackson, a 25-year-old San Bernardino resident, has been in custody since 2019 following his involvement in a murder case. He had previously accepted a plea deal and was sentenced to 50 years to life in prison. In light of the recent incident, Jackson is set to face additional charges of attempted murder.

San Bernardino Sheriff Shannon Dicus expressed concern over the violent behaviour displayed by Jackson, emphasizing the serious threat it poses to the safety and security of both staff and inmates within the facility.
